Choosing the Right Island for Your Package
Oahu: The Gathering Place
Oahu is the most populated Hawaiian island. It is home to Honolulu and Waikiki Beach. Oahu offers a mix of city life and natural beauty. You can shop in luxury stores. Then hike to stunning waterfalls. The island has rich history and culture.
Oahu is great for first-time visitors. It has excellent infrastructure. There are many hotels and restaurants. The famous North Shore has big waves in winter. Waikiki has calm waters year-round.
Must-see attractions on Oahu:
- Pearl Harbor Memorial
- Diamond Head State Monument
- Hanauma Bay Nature Preserve
- North Shore beaches
- Polynesian Cultural Center
Maui: The Valley Isle
Maui is known for luxury and romance. It has beautiful resorts and golf courses. The Road to Hana is famous for its scenic drive. Haleakala volcano offers amazing sunrise views. Maui has some of Hawaii's best beaches.
Maui is perfect for couples and luxury travelers. It has world-class dining and shopping. The whale watching is excellent in winter. The island has a relaxed, upscale vibe.
Top experiences on Maui:
- Sunrise at Haleakala National Park
- Driving the Road to Hana
- Whale watching tours
- Snorkeling at Molokini Crater
- Beach time at Ka'anapali
Kauai: The Garden Isle
Kauai is the greenest Hawaiian island. It has dramatic cliffs and lush valleys. The Na Pali Coast is world-famous. You can only see it by boat, helicopter, or hiking. Kauai has a slow, natural pace.
Kauai is ideal for nature lovers and adventurers. It has great hiking and kayaking. The island receives more rain than others. This creates its beautiful green landscapes. There are fewer large resorts here.
Kauai highlights include:
- Na Pali Coast State Wilderness Park
- Waimea Canyon State Park
- Wailua River kayaking
- Hanalei Bay beaches
- Movie location tours
Big Island: Hawaii's Adventure Playground
The Big Island is the largest Hawaiian island. It has active volcanoes and diverse climates. You can visit black sand beaches and snow-capped mountains. The island is still growing from volcanic activity.
The Big Island offers unique experiences. You can see flowing lava at Hawaii Volcanoes National Park. You can swim with manta rays at night. You can visit coffee farms and macadamia nut plantations.
Big Island must-dos:
- Hawaii Volcanoes National Park
- Manta ray night snorkeling
- Kona coffee farm tours
- Green sand beach at Papakolea
- Mauna Kea stargazing
Lanai and Molokai: The Private Islands
Lanai and Molokai are smaller, quieter islands. They offer privacy and seclusion. Lanai has luxury resorts owned by Larry Ellison. Molokai has a strong Native Hawaiian culture. Both islands have limited tourist facilities.
These islands are perfect for escaping crowds. They offer authentic Hawaiian experiences. You need to plan carefully. There are fewer hotels and restaurants. The pace is very slow and relaxed.
What to know about these islands:
- Fewer flight options
- Limited dining choices
- More expensive accommodations
- Strong cultural preservation
- Excellent privacy and seclusion
When to Book Your Hawaii Vacation Package
Best Time to Visit Hawaii
Hawaii has good weather year-round. But some times are better than others. The high season is from mid-December to March. This is when prices are highest. The weather is slightly cooler. There is more rain in winter.
The shoulder seasons are spring and fall. April to June and September to November are great. The weather is pleasant. Crowds are smaller. Prices are more reasonable.
Summer months are popular with families. June through August sees many visitors. The weather is warm and dry. The ocean is calm for swimming and snorkeling.
Booking Timeline
Timing your booking is important for getting good deals. For peak season travel, book 6-9 months in advance. For shoulder season, 3-6 months ahead is good. Last-minute deals can be found 1-2 months before travel.
The American Automobile Association recommends booking Hawaii packages at least 4 months in advance. This ensures the best selection of hotels and flights. It also gives you time to plan activities.
Booking timeline guide:
- 9-12 months: Complex itineraries, large groups
- 6-9 months: Peak season travel, specific resorts
- 3-6 months: Shoulder season, good availability
- 1-3 months: Last-minute deals, flexible travelers
- 0-1 month: Risky but possible, limited choices
Seasonal Considerations
Each season in Hawaii offers different experiences. Winter brings big waves to north shores. This is great for surfing watching. Whale watching is best from December to April. Summer has calmer oceans for swimming.
Holiday periods are very busy. Christmas and New Year require early booking. Spring break sees many families. Summer vacation is popular with teachers and students.
Seasonal highlights:
- Winter: Whale watching, big wave surfing
- Spring: Whale season ending, pleasant weather
- Summer: Calm seas, great for water activities
- Fall: Fewer crowds, good weather continues
